Milijana Petrović from Zemun, whose daughter Anđela suffers from a rare metabolic disorder, spoke about how her daughter received a drug costing 570,000 euros at the state's expense in October last year to halt the progression of the disease.

TL;DR
- Anđela Petrović suffers from an extremely rare metabolic disorder, which caused her to develop a high fever at age 11 and led to partial blindness.
- After a decade of searching for a diagnosis and treatment, including abroad, doctors identified a drug costing €570,000 annually.
- Milijana Petrović appealed to President Aleksandar Vučić for state funding, which was approved within three days.
- The drug, received in October of the previous year, has begun to show positive effects on Anđela's photoreceptors.
- Milijana publicly thanks President Vučić and the state, emphasizing that the government provided the necessary medication and did not abandon her child.
